Dar Al Safa Computer Spare Parts Trdg - Al Mowaileh Suburb

4.5

Sharjah, al mowaileh suburb sheikh mohammed bin zayed street

Similar Places in al mowaileh suburb

Sharjah, al mowaileh suburb sheikh mohammed bin zayed street

0502133780

Computer Supplies & Accessories Computer

Sharjah, al mowaileh suburb

065343023

Computer Services, Systems & Equipment Suppliers Computer

Sharjah, al mowaileh suburb sheikh mohammed bin zayed street

065346255

Computer Services, Systems & Equipment Suppliers Computer